Two Ardmore residents have man­aged to walk away with the U. S. Com­merce Association’s 2009 Best of Santa Fe Award in the bed and breakfast cat­egory.

Dr. Ron Bulard purchased The Wa­ter Street Inn in May and a month later, family friend, DeeAnn Skidmore agreed to move from Ardmore to Santa Fe to become the inn’s manager. By the end of the year the pair had garnered the prestigious award through the USCA “Best of Local Business” award programs. Each year, the USCA iden­tifies companies that have achieved exceptional marketing success in their local communities and business cat­egories. Selections are based on firms who have enhanced the positive image of small business through service to their customers and community. Win­ners are selected through a variety of information, which is gathered and analyzed. The 2009 USCA Award Pro­gram focused on quality, not quantity. Winners are determined based on the
information gathered both internally by the USCA and data provided by third parties.

In a recent interview Skidmore talk­ed about the Santa Fe venture.

“The quaint charm, the beauti­ful scenery, the bountiful shopping which includes fine art and fine din­ing brought Dr. Bulard to Santa Fe for a visit. He was so impressed with the area and taking into consideration Santa Fe is one of the top 10 favorite destination cities in the USA, decided to expand his business portfolio and venture into the hospitality industry in Santa Fe. That decision led him to The Water Street Inn,” Skidmore said.

The inn is an adobe restoration lo­cated three blocks from the historic Downtown Santa Fe Plaza. The bed and breakfast features 11 rooms, in­dividually decorated in the southwest style and includes kiva fireplaces and a bevy of amenities. In addition the inn features hot gourmet breakfast and happy hour hors d’oeuvres.
